Artificial Intelligence and Predictive Modeling in the Management and Treatment of Episodic Migraine.

Abstract

PURPOSE OF REVIEW: Artificial intelligence (AI) has impacted different aspects of headache medicine, from history taking and diagnosis to drug development. AI has been shown to have predictive modeling in helping diagnose migraine and assist with patient care. Additionally, this technology has been adapted to help non-headache specialists with headache management. Similar practices have expanded to help diagnose cluster headache. AI has also been used to help streamline patient visits, and identify new drug targets.
